    The High Stakes of Construction Oversight in NYC

    In the dense urban fabric of the five boroughs, your project is always under a microscope. Whether you are navigating a Brownfield Cleanup Program or managing a site under an "E" Designation, the Community Air Monitoring Plan (CAMP) is your bible.

    The standard CAMP requires continuous monitoring for volatile organic compounds (VOCs) and particulate matter (PM-10) at the upwind and downwind boundaries of the exclusion zone. If those levels cross a certain threshold, work must stop. If you don't have the data to prove you took action, you're looking at heavy fines and a tarnished reputation with the regulators.

    Why the "E" Matters More Than You Think

    An E-Designation is a NYC zoning map designation that flags environmental requirements on a tax lot. It stays with the property until OER confirms the required work is complete. If you’re searching for how to remove an NYC E-Designation or how to complete an NYC OER cleanup, this is the core issue: the designation does not go away just because construction is almost done.

    The biggest point of friction? The DOB will not issue a final C of O for sites with a Hazardous Materials E-Designation until the OER issues a Notice of Satisfaction (NOS). OER’s own program materials make that workflow clear, and NYC ties E-Designation compliance directly to project closeout and occupancy milestones (NYC OER).

    If you haven’t planned for this, you’re looking at a massive bottleneck. You can have the most beautiful glass tower in Brooklyn, but if the active E-Designation is not resolved and the OER cleanup is not properly closed out, your tenants aren't moving in.

    The Standard Roadmap: From Investigation to Satisfaction

    Most developers know the basic steps, but few execute them in a way that prioritizes speed. If your goal is removing an NYC E-Designation fast, the key is not skipping steps. It’s sequencing the OER cleanup process correctly from day one. Here is the path generally required by OER:

    1. Phase II Subsurface Investigation: You need a Remedial Investigation Report (RIR). This isn't just a "check the box" document; it’s the foundation of your entire remediation strategy.
    2. Remedial Action Work Plan (RAWP): This document tells the OER exactly how you plan to fix the issues found in the RIR. It includes a Construction Health and Safety Plan (CHASP).
    3. Notice to Proceed (NTP): This is the golden ticket. Once the OER issues the NTP, you can finally pull your building permits from the DOB.
    4. Remediation Execution: This happens during construction. You need a Qualified Environmental Professional (QEP) on-site to oversee soil disposal, vapor barrier installation, or whatever else the RAWP dictates.
    5. Remedial Action Report (RAR): Once the work is done, you document everything.
    6. Notice of Satisfaction (NOS): The OER reviews the RAR and, if satisfied, issues the NOS. This is what the DOB needs to release your C of O.

    Insider Tip #2: Coordinate the "Air and Noise" Dance Early

    Many developers focus so hard on soil (Hazardous Materials) that they forget about the Air and Noise E-Designations. Unlike hazmat, which is often dealt with during excavation, Air and Noise requirements are built into the fabric of the building: think specific window OITC ratings or HVAC stacks.

    To remove an Air or Noise E-Designation, you have to provide installation reports proving that the building was constructed exactly as planned. If you swap out a window spec at the last minute to save a few bucks, you might accidentally disqualify yourself from an E-Designation removal, triggering a nightmare of retrofitting.

    What New York Lenders Actually Require

    image_1

    New York's banking institutions have evolved specific expectations beyond standard ASTM guidelines. Major commercial lenders in the NYC metro area: including regional banks handling significant real estate portfolios: consistently demand these elements:

    Professional Qualifications and Oversight

    Your Phase II must be completed by qualified environmental professionals with active New York State licenses. This typically means licensed professional geologists (P.G.) or professional engineers (P.E.) who can legally stamp reports in New York. Lenders increasingly reject reports supervised by out-of-state consultants without proper NY credentials.

    Comprehensive Site Investigation Scope

    Banks want evidence that your investigation actually addressed the contamination risks identified in the Phase I ESA. This means:

    • Soil sampling at appropriate intervals based on property size and suspected contamination sources
    • Groundwater monitoring when RECs suggest subsurface impacts
    • Vapor intrusion assessment for properties with volatile organic compound concerns
    • Waste characterization if contaminated soil requires off-site disposal

    The investigation scope should directly correlate with Phase I findings. If your Phase I identified three potential contamination sources but your Phase II only sampled one area, expect pushback.

    Laboratory Standards and Chain of Custody

    All analytical work must use NYSDOH Environmental Laboratory Approval Program (ELAP) certified laboratories. This isn't negotiable for New York properties. Out-of-state labs without ELAP certification will trigger automatic report rejection.

    Documentation requirements include:

    • Complete chain of custody records for all samples
    • Laboratory certifications and detection limit verification
    • Quality assurance/quality control (QA/QC) sample results
    • Analytical method references and holding time compliance

    Regulatory Standards Comparison

    Your Phase II conclusions must compare all detected contamination against relevant regulatory standards. For New York properties, this means referencing:

    • NYSDEC Soil Cleanup Objectives (SCOs) for unrestricted use
    • NYSDEC Class GA groundwater standards
    • EPA Regional Screening Levels (RSLs) for vapor intrusion assessment

    Simply stating "no contamination detected" isn't sufficient. Lenders want explicit comparison of detected concentrations against applicable cleanup standards, even for non-detect results.

    Risk Evaluation and Liability Assessment

    Banks need clear answers about environmental liability. Your report must address:

    Current Risk Level: Is contamination present at concentrations requiring immediate action?

    Regulatory Status: Are there existing orders, violations, or ongoing oversight by environmental agencies?

    Future Liability: What contamination management requirements will transfer to the new owner?

    Cost Implications: Rough order-of-magnitude costs for any necessary remediation or long-term monitoring.

    Reliance and Transferability Language

    This is where many reports fail. Your Phase II must include explicit reliance language allowing:

    • Lender review and reliance on findings
    • Transfer of reliance rights to future loan servicers
    • Assignment of consultant liability to subsequent property owners
    • Clear limitation of consultant liability scope and duration

    Standard professional services agreements often don't include adequate reliance provisions for commercial lending. Work with your legal counsel to develop lender-acceptable language that protects both your firm and enables smooth transaction closing.

    New York-Specific Regulatory Considerations

    image_3

    E-Designation and Environmental Restrictive Declarations

    Properties with New York City E-Designations require specialized Phase II approaches. Your investigation must address the specific contamination concerns identified in the E-Designation while providing data adequate for (E) Environmental Requirements compliance.

    For properties with Environmental Restrictive Declarations, your Phase II must demonstrate compliance with existing use restrictions and evaluate whether contamination levels support the intended future use.

    Brownfield Cleanup Program Integration

    If the property is enrolled in New York's Brownfield Cleanup Program (BCP), your Phase II should reference existing Remedial Investigation data and evaluate consistency with approved cleanup goals. Lenders want assurance that your findings align with state-approved remediation standards.

    Vapor Intrusion Requirements

    New York has specific vapor intrusion guidance that differs from EPA standards. Your Phase II must follow NYSDOH Guidance for Evaluating Soil Vapor Intrusion when investigating properties with volatile contamination concerns.

    Unpacking the New "Affordable Housing" Definition

    Under the updated 6 NYCRR Part 375 framework, affordable housing now carries a specific, measurable threshold. The definition aligns with federal standards: housing where total monthly housing costs do not exceed 30% of monthly household income for households earning no more than 80% of the area median income (AMI).

    This isn't just theoretical. It's how NYSDEC will evaluate your BCP application.

    Here's what that looks like in practice for a Manhattan project in 2026:

    • 80% AMI for a family of four in Manhattan: approximately $92,000 annually
    • Maximum monthly housing cost: $2,300 (30% of $92,000/12)
    • Your project must guarantee units at or below this threshold to qualify

    The catch? You need to maintain this affordability threshold for the entire regulatory agreement period, typically 30 years. This isn't a "build it and flip it" scenario. You're committing to long-term affordability restrictions in exchange for tax credit acceleration.

    NYSDEC also requires documentation proving your project meets these thresholds before you can claim enhanced BCP credits. That means locked-in partnership agreements with affordable housing agencies, recorded deed restrictions, and regulatory compliance certificates, all before you break ground.

    What Counts as "Underutilized" Now?

    The updated "underutilized" definition is equally specific and potentially more lucrative for developers sitting on marginal urban properties.

    A site qualifies as underutilized if it meets any of these criteria:

    • Vacant for two or more years prior to BCP application
    • Occupied by structures with less than 50% utilization of allowable floor area ratio (FAR) under current zoning
    • Generating tax revenue less than 50% of what a fully developed site would produce under existing zoning

    This is where smart developers can turn overlooked properties into goldmines. That half-empty industrial warehouse in Long Island City? If it's using only 40% of its allowable FAR and has been sitting partially vacant for three years, it likely qualifies.

    But here's the critical piece: you need documentary proof of underutilization. NYSDEC isn't taking your word for it. You'll need:

    • Property tax records showing assessed value vs. potential value
    • Vacancy documentation (utility bills, lease records, inspection reports)
    • Zoning analysis demonstrating underbuilt FAR
    • Historical site usage documentation

    Why OER and DOB Coordination Fails (and How We Fix It)

    The disconnect usually happens because the environmental team and the structural team are speaking different languages. The OER cares about soil vapor, heavy metals, and "clean" backfill. The DOB cares about structural stability, fire safety, and egress.

    Here is where the friction occurs:

    1. Vapor Barriers vs. Foundation Waterproofing: You need both. But if the specific vapor barrier required by your OER-approved RAP doesn’t meet the DOB’s building code for waterproofing or structural integrity, you’re back to the drawing board.
    2. Soil Disposal vs. Support of Excavation (SOE): If you have to dig deeper to reach "clean" soil for the OER, your SOE plans (which the DOB must approve) might need a total redesign to prevent the neighboring building from shifting.
    3. Ventilation Systems: Sub-slab Depressurization Systems (SSDS) are common in OER cleanups. These systems need to be integrated into the building’s mechanical and electrical plans. If they aren't in the initial DOB filing, expect a long "disapproved" notice in your future.

    Phase I: The Identification Phase (The Search for "Smoke")

    A Phase I ESA is essentially a historical deep dive. Think of it as a background check for a piece of land. Governed by the ASTM E1527-21 standard, this phase involves zero physical sampling. Instead, we are looking for "Recognized Environmental Conditions" (RECs).

    A REC is defined as the presence or likely presence of hazardous substances or petroleum products in, on, or at a property. Our team scours decades of municipal records, aerial photographs, and Sanborn Fire Insurance maps to answer one question: Is there any reason to suspect this site is contaminated?

    When is a Phase I Enough?

    You can usually stop at Phase I if the report comes back "clean": meaning no RECs were identified. This typically happens with:

    • Properties with a well-documented history of low-impact use (e.g., greenfields or modern office parks).
    • Sites where previous remediation has already been closed out with a No Further Action (NFA) letter or a Response Action Outcome (RAO) from a Licensed Site Remediation Professional (LSRP).

    If the history is clear and the "search for smoke" comes up empty, you have successfully de-risked your acquisition. You’ve satisfied the requirements for the "Innocent Landowner Defense" under CERCLA, and you can move toward closing with confidence.

    Aerial View with Monitoring Locations

    The Turning Point: When the "Smoke" Becomes a "Fire"

    The decision to move to a Phase II ESA is triggered when a Phase I identifies a REC that cannot be explained away. In the New Jersey market, common triggers include:

    1. Historical Industrial Use: If the site was a machine shop in the 1950s, there’s a high probability of solvent or heavy metal presence.
    2. Underground Storage Tanks (USTs): Even if a tank was "removed," if there’s no documentation of soil sampling from the closure, it remains a REC.
    3. Dry Cleaners: Tetrachloroethylene (PCE) is a persistent "forever chemical" that often necessitates a closer look.
    4. Adjacent Threats: Sometimes the problem isn’t on your site, but the gas station next door has a known plume migrating your way.

    As the research indicates, Phase I is about identification, while Phase II is about evaluation. If Phase I tells us where to look, Phase II tells us what is actually there.

    Phase II: The Evaluation Phase (Quantifying the Risk)

    Once a Phase II is triggered, we move from the library to the field. This is the "subsurface investigation." We aren't just looking for smoke anymore; we are measuring the heat of the fire.

    In New Jersey, a Phase II ESA typically involves:

    • Soil Borings: Collecting soil samples at various depths to check for contaminants.
    • Groundwater Monitoring: Installing temporary or permanent wells to see if pollutants have reached the water table.
    • Vapor Intrusion Screening: Testing the air pockets beneath a building's slab to ensure toxic gases aren't seeping into the indoor environment.

    The goal of Phase II is to determine if the RECs identified in Phase I actually represent a violation of NJDEP Technical Requirements for Site Remediation (N.J.A.C. 7:26E).

    The New Jersey Factor: The Role of the LSRP

    In New Jersey, you don't just "do" environmental work; you navigate a specific regulatory ecosystem. Since the Site Remediation Reform Act (SRRA), the responsibility for overseeing remediation has shifted from the NJDEP to Licensed Site Remediation Professionals (LSRPs).

    An LSRP has the authority to issue a Response Action Outcome (RAO), which is the "Gold Seal" of environmental closure in NJ. When we conduct a Phase II for a client, our LSRPs aren't just checking boxes. They are looking for the most efficient path to that RAO. This might involve using the Linear Construction Program or leveraging "capping" strategies to leave some materials in place safely, rather than hauling everything to a landfill at a massive cost.

    Incremental Sampling Methodology (ISM)

    For larger sites or uneven fill areas, a single grab sample can overstate or understate conditions. Incremental Sampling Methodology (ISM) helps smooth out that problem by combining many small increments into one representative sample from a defined decision unit.

    That matters when a lender is trying to understand whether soil impacts are isolated or broad-based. ITRC has published guidance showing why ISM can improve representativeness in the right setting (ITRC ISM guidance).

    Direct-Push Technology (DPT)

    In dense NJ/NY settings, access is tight and schedules are tighter. Direct-Push Technology (DPT) often lets us collect more targeted data with less disturbance than larger drilling methods. It can be a strong fit for:

    • fast screening around former USTs
    • focused soil and groundwater delineation
    • constrained urban lots
    • projects where turnaround time matters to the closing schedule

    The "Boring" Stuff That Saves Deals: QA/QC

    The difference between a lender accepting your report and pushing back on it often comes down to QA/QC. This is the structure behind the data, and it matters more than most people think.

    1. Chain of Custody: Every sample needs to be tracked from collection through lab receipt.
    2. Equipment Decontamination: If tools aren’t cleaned properly, the data can be questioned.
    3. Proper Well Construction: If groundwater sampling is part of the scope, the well has to be installed and developed correctly.
    4. Correct Analytical Match: The lab methods need to fit the site history and likely contaminants of concern.
    5. Detection Limits That Make Sense: If reporting limits are too high, the data may be technically complete but practically useless for lender review.
